Ghana: Congratulating new President, UN chief thanks outgoing leader for preserving peace during polls

| | Dec 11, 2016, at 04:41 am
New York, Dec 10 (Just Earth News): United Nations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on has congratulated the Nana Akufo-Addo on his election as President of Ghana and thanked outgoing President John Dramani Mahama for his role in defusing tensions and preserving peace during the election period.

According to a statement issued by his office late yesterday, Mr. Ban reiterated UN’s commitment to continue assisting the Government of Ghana in consolidating democratic and development achievements.

The UN chief also congratulated the people of the African nation, who turned out in large numbers to participate in the presidential and parliamentary elections on 7 December, and commended the country’s Electoral Commission for successfully organizing the elections.
